General Placement and Set-up Tips

  • Place the subwoofer, powered speakers or amplifier at its intended location
  • Try to maintain line-of-sight (no walls or solid barriers) between the transmitter and receiver for best results.
  • Receiver should be within 65 feet of transmitter for best results
  • Avoid placing the transmitter next to devices that could create signal interference, such as mobile phones, baby monitors, 2.4 GHz wireless phones and 2.4 GHz Wi-Fi routers.

Connecting the Wireless Receiver to your Subwoofer

  1. For AV processor applications, connect the 3.5 mm to single RCA adapter cable to the LFE input and the input on the wireless receiver.
  2. For 2-channel stereo pre-amp applications connect the 3.5 mm to dual RCA adapter cable to both the L and R subwoofer inputs and to the input on the wireless receiver.
  3. Connect the USB A to Micro B cable to the wireless receiver and the 5 VDC power supply.
  4. Connect the 5 VDC power supply to a 100V~240V AC outlet.

Pairing the Transmitter and Receiver

  1. The transmitter and receiver are synched at the time of manufacture and will pair automatically when connected and powered on.\
  2. Successful pairing will be indicated by a steady blue light on the transmitter and receiver.
  3. Press and hold the small button on one unit (it doesn’t matter which one you select) until the blue light starts blinking.
  4. Immediately walk over to the other unit and press/hold the small button until the blue light starts blinking.
  5. Both will blink a few times then turn solid blue when they are successfully paired.

FAQs and Troubleshooting

Does my AV processor correct for the latency (time delay) of the wireless unit?
Yes, this will be reflected in a longer than normal subwoofer distance, as shown under the set-up section of the AV processor. An additional 25-28 feet (beyond the actual subwoofer distance) is normal.

I keep hearing interference artifacts or experiencing signal drop-outs – how can I correct for this?
Always try to keep a line-of-sight between the transmitter and receiver units with no hard barriers or walls between them.
Avoid placing other 2.4 GHz devices near the units like wireless phones, mobile phones, Wi-Fi routers, baby monitors, etc.
